When Are the Oscars 2026? Date, Time, Location and How to Watch

If you’re wondering when are the Oscars 2026, the 98th Academy Awards are officially set for Sunday, March 15, 2026. Hollywood’s biggest night will once again bring together the film industry’s top talent for a live ceremony honoring the best movies released in 2025.

The event will take place at the iconic Dolby Theatre in Los Angeles and air live across the United States. Here’s everything you need to know about the confirmed date, time, location, host, and viewing options.


Official Date and Time

The 98th Academy Awards will be held on:

  • Date: Sunday, March 15, 2026
  • Time: 7:00 p.m. Eastern Time
  • Time: 4:00 p.m. Pacific Time

The ceremony traditionally airs on Sunday evenings, giving viewers across the country a prime-time broadcast. Red carpet coverage is expected to begin earlier in the evening, leading into the live awards presentation.


Where the Ceremony Will Take Place

The Oscars will return to the Dolby Theatre at Ovation Hollywood in Los Angeles, California. The venue has hosted the Academy Awards since 2002 and remains the permanent home of the ceremony.

Located in the heart of Hollywood, the Dolby Theatre seats more than 3,000 guests. Its stage has become one of the most recognized platforms in the entertainment world. Each year, nominees, presenters, and performers gather there for an evening that celebrates artistic achievement in filmmaking.


Who Is Hosting the 2026 Oscars?

Conan O’Brien will host the ceremony for the second consecutive year. The comedian and longtime television personality previously led the broadcast to strong audience engagement and positive reactions.

How to Watch in the United States

U.S. viewers will have multiple ways to tune in live:

  • Network Broadcast: ABC
  • Streaming Option: Hulu (live stream for subscribers)

The broadcast begins at 7:00 p.m. ET. Viewers in the Central and Mountain time zones can adjust accordingly. Many cable and streaming packages that include ABC will also carry the live event.

Red carpet coverage typically starts about 30 minutes before the main show. That portion includes celebrity interviews, fashion highlights, and nominee reactions.


Important Dates Leading Up to the Ceremony

Awards season follows a structured timeline. Here are the key confirmed milestones for the 98th Academy Awards:

  • Nominations Announcement: January 22, 2026
  • Nominees Luncheon: February 10, 2026
  • Final Voting Deadline: March 5, 2026
  • Academy Awards Ceremony: March 15, 2026
  • Scientific and Technical Awards: April 28, 2026

The nominations announcement in January officially kicked off the final phase of awards season. After final voting concludes in early March, winners remain confidential until envelopes are opened live on stage.


What the Oscars Recognize

The Academy Awards honor excellence in cinematic achievement. Categories include:

  • Best Picture
  • Best Director
  • Best Actor and Best Actress
  • Supporting Acting Categories
  • Screenplay Awards
  • Cinematography
  • Editing
  • Production Design
  • Costume Design
  • Original Score and Original Song

A new competitive category for Best Casting is being introduced, marking a historic expansion in the Academy’s recognition of behind-the-scenes contributions.

Each award is voted on by members of the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ences, which includes thousands of film professionals across multiple disciplines.
